From the Mouth of Babes

Today I mediated a conflict between three children. I love that in our school we have the time to go through this process with the children. A little girl who had been feeling hurt expressed herself while the other two children listened and then she made a request of them. They agreed to the request. 

One of the other children also made a request and all of them even made suggestions as to what to do if, for some reason, one of them didn't hold true to their word. In the end, they all hugged each other and went back in the classroom to work on a project together. 

Wow, I wish to see the day when adults handle things with as much grace and courage as these children.
